Location: Head Office – Markham, Ontario
Position Summary
In this hybrid position, the Senior Project Engineer with take a lead role in researching, designing and developing new products for the markets our Client services (Electrical/Lighting and HVAC). In this hands-on role, the key individual will take their inspiration from ideation to commercialization and drive towards the financial goals and objectives of the organization.

Qualifications & Skills
- Bachelor's or Master's degree in Mechanical Engineering or a related field.
- Certification in Project Management is an asset.
- Minimum of 8-10 years of experience in mechanical engineering and project management roles, with a proven track record of successful project delivery.
- Proficient in CAD software, Solid Works, and other engineering design tools.
- Strong Knowledge and understanding of materials
- Excellent communication, interpersonal, and leadership skills.
- Strong problem-solving and analytical skills.
- Familiarity with relevant industry standards and regulations.
- Must show initiative and pay attention to details.
- Team players, self-motivated and has a positive and engaging personality.
- Excellent speaking, writing and presentation skills required.
- Understanding of relevant certification code and standards.
